| General comment | Neodymium (III) fluoride is an inorganic chemical compound of neodymium and fluorine. It is a purplish pink colored solid with a high melting point. Neodymium is the fourth member of the lanthanide series. It has a melting point of 1,024 °C (1,875 °F) and a boiling point of 3,074 °C (5,565 °F). Neodymium Fluoride is a water insoluble neodymium source for use in oxygen-sensitive applications, such as metal production. |
